Automotive exhibitions represent the ultimate stress test for any flooring system. Vehicles weighing several tons must be driven onto the show floor, positioned with precision, and displayed on rotating turntables. The raised access flooring tiles used in these high-end exhibition halls must possess extraordinary concentrated load and rolling load capacities. High Load-Bearing All-Steel Raised Access Floors are typically deployed here. The underfloor space is ingeniously utilized to route heavy-duty power cables for dramatic lighting rigs and vehicle charging stations, ensuring the visible floor area remains pristine and free of tripping hazards. Furthermore, the rigid structural integrity of the steel core prevents any micro-deflections that could disrupt the highly polished reflections essential for automotive photography.
When the world's leading tech giants converge, the exhibition hall transforms into a temporary, massive data center. Thousands of booths require instantaneous, high-bandwidth internet connections, dedicated server power, and intricate audiovisual setups. In this scenario, Slotted All-Steel Raised Access Floors and Anti-Static Ventilated Tiles are indispensable. The slotted designs allow for seamless cable management directly to the exhibitor's desk without drilling or damaging the panels. Meanwhile, the anti-static properties (ESD) protect sensitive microprocessors and VR equipment from electrostatic discharge. Ventilated tiles are strategically placed to allow underfloor air distribution (UFAD) to cool down temporary server racks, maintaining optimal operating temperatures in densely packed tech pavilions.
For high-end fashion, jewelry, and fine art exhibitions, the visual experience is paramount. The flooring must complement the luxury of the items on display. Here, Durable Woodcore Anti-Static Floors and High-Strength Transparent Glass Raised Access Floors take center stage. Woodcore panels offer a superior acoustic performance, dampening the sound of foot traffic to create a serene, gallery-like atmosphere. They can be finished with premium materials like marble, granite, or luxury vinyl tile (LVT). Transparent glass flooring tiles are increasingly used by avant-garde designers to create illuminated underfloor displays, where artifacts or dynamic lighting arrays are showcased beneath the visitors' feet, adding a breathtaking dimension to the spatial design.
Modern exhibition halls frequently host concurrent, smaller-scale events that require rapid turnaround times. Lightweight GRC Inorganic Raised Access Floors are the preferred choice for these dynamic environments. Their reduced weight significantly lowers the physical strain on installation crews and accelerates the setup and teardown processes. Despite being lightweight, these inorganic tiles offer exceptional fire resistance (Class A1) and dimensional stability, ensuring that temporary modular booths stand on a perfectly leveled and secure foundation, complying with the strictest municipal fire and safety codes.

When architects and specifiers design modern exhibition spaces, selecting the right core material is critical. All-Steel Panels filled with lightweight cementitious compounds offer the ultimate in point-load resistance, making them the standard for heavy duty zones. Woodcore Panels, constructed from high-density particleboard encapsulated in galvanized steel, offer an excellent balance of cost, weight, and acoustic dampening, ideal for VIP lounges and quiet zones. Calcium Sulphate Panels (Inorganic) provide the highest fire rating and environmental sustainability, favored in regions with strict ecological building codes.
